1970: The SUPER KITCHEN of the FUTURE! | Tomorrow's World | Retro Tech | BBC Archive
Are you tired of all that exercise you do around the kitchen? Let your kitchen do the walking for you!
youtube
All in orange, of course.
William Woollard (born 23 August 1939) British historian and retired television producer and presenter) tests out a new 'Super Kitchen' - which uses futuristic design technology to minimize space, maximize storage and optimise cooking efficiency.
The centrepiece of tomorrow's kitchen is a revolving cylindrical column, which contains cupboard space, a dishwasher, a microwave oven, a refrigerator and a double oven. Ceiling units contain concealed lighting, storage units and plastic dispensers. The real revolution however, is a built-in domestic computer terminal, which you can use to quickly access recipes and work out cooking times. With all this state-of-the-art technology, the super kitchen of the future will make cooking so easy, even a man will be able do it.
Clip taken from Tomorrow's World, originally broadcast on BBC One, 24 December, 1970.
